How Far From McQuady to ...
We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ers & Almanacs that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as McQuady to various places of note, such as the White House.
With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ance<2> beginning in McQuady and extending to:
- Hardinsburg, which is the Seat of Breckinridge County, lies just to the North Northeast.
- Frankfort, which is the State Capital of Kentucky, lies 95 miles [152.9 km]<2> to the east northeast (ENE). If you could drive a straight line from McQuady to Frankfort, with an average speed<3>of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, it would take less than two hours to make the trip. A comfortable walk of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our would take 6 days.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take three full days.
- The White House (Washington, DC) is 520 miles [836.9 km] to the east northeast (ENE). Driving would take just over a day, a buggy would take 21 days and walking would take 30 days.
